CiviCRM Community Forums (archive)

*

News:

Have a question about CiviCRM?
Get it answered quickly at the new
CiviCRM Stack Exchange Q+A site

This forum was archived on 25 November 2017. Learn more.
How to get involved.
What to do if you think you've found a bug.



  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Using CiviCRM »
  • Using CiviContribute (Moderator: Donald Lobo) »
  • Receipt for recurring contributions with Authorize.net is very delayed
Pages: [1]

Author Topic: Receipt for recurring contributions with Authorize.net is very delayed  (Read 499 times)

lesliejmatthews

  • I’m new here
  • *
  • Posts: 14
  • Karma: 1
  • CiviCRM version: 4.4.6
  • CMS version: drupal 7
  • MySQL version: 5.5.31
  • PHP version: 5.3.1
Receipt for recurring contributions with Authorize.net is very delayed
March 30, 2014, 11:06:31 am
Hi

I'm posting a revised version of a previous question in the hopes that maybe it will make more sense and get a response.

I am using authorize.net as payment processor.  The problem is that for first-time recurring contributions, the donor does not get any email acknowledgement for up to 24 hours.  I would like to figure out a way to get an email acknowledgement sent from CiviCRM immediately, so the donor doesn't worry that something went wrong.  A second acknowledgement/receipt would follow the first acknowledgement, once the transaction was completed at Authorize.net.

I believe that the problem is that the recurring credit card payment doesn't get processed by Authorize until 2am.  Therefore, the customer who signs up as a recurring donor on our web site does not receive a receipt from Civicrm for as much as 24 hours, instead of almost immediately.  This is troublesome, since most are accustomed to promptly receiving email confirmation from web sites when they use their credit card, for example to make a purchase.  Also, one-time donors receive email confirmation immediately, raising expectations that recurring donors would as well.

Can anyone point me in the direction of the code to look at that triggers sending the recurring donation to the donor?

Or if anyone can suggest to me any way of triggering an immediate acknowledgement from civicrm for a pending recurring contribution that would be helpful too.

Thanks!

Leslie

ptpmark

  • I post occasionally
  • **
  • Posts: 48
  • Karma: 1
  • CiviCRM version: 4.4.6
  • CMS version: Drupal 7.22
  • MySQL version: 5.1.66
  • PHP version: 5.3.3
Re: Receipt for recurring contributions with Authorize.net is very delayed
May 02, 2014, 08:06:00 am
Hi,
I think you are right, this is a result of delay in authorize.net's process for handling arb events. I don't know what code you would write, but you might want to provide a confirmation page that says the confirmation email will come out within 24 hours.  Either that or manually send them. 

Pages: [1]
  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Using CiviCRM »
  • Using CiviContribute (Moderator: Donald Lobo) »
  • Receipt for recurring contributions with Authorize.net is very delayed

This forum was archived on 2017-11-26.